Kimoto Co EBIT Calculation

EBIT, sometimes also called Earnings Before Interest and Taxes, is a measure of a firm's profit that includes all expenses except interest and income tax expenses. It is the difference between operating revenues and operating expenses. When a firm does not have non-operating income, then Operating Income is sometimes used as a synonym for EBIT and operating profit.

Kimoto Co Business Description

Address 450 Kyoganoshinden, Kitaseicho, Mie Prefecture, Inabe, JPN, 160-0022
Kimoto Co Ltd is a Japanese company involved in the manufacture and sale of various films for computer output, electrical equipment, printed circuits, optical equipment, and environmental measurements, among others.
